Назад | Перейти на главную страницу

Трансляция UDP через VPN

У меня настроен OpenVPN и 5 клиентов маршрутизатора dd-wrt. Я хотел бы, чтобы машины на этих маршрутизаторах имели возможность широковещательной передачи UDP во всех 5 сетях.

Я не могу соединить интерфейсы (насколько мне известно), потому что каждый маршрутизатор должен иметь возможность работать самостоятельно, если соединение VPN умирает (dhcp должен работать).

в настоящее время каждый маршрутизатор имеет свою собственную сеть / 24 (например, 192.168.1.x). Есть ли способ использовать IPTables для искажения udp и пересылки их всем VPN-клиентам?

Подводя итог, мне нужно
1) для UDP-трансляции всем маршрутизаторам и их клиентам
2) чтобы все маршрутизаторы могли работать независимо в случае отказа VPN

Как сказал @James, вы, вероятно, захотите исследовать использование многоадресной рассылки. Обычная широковещательная IP-рассылка не проходит через маршрутизатор, и точка завершения VPN (обычно) маршрутизируется, а не соединяется по мосту из соображений эффективности сети.

Я читал о решениях cisco vpn, поэтому это может быть применимо к вам, но я не могу этого гарантировать.

Я бы посмотрел на GRE туннели поскольку они позволяют многоадресной рассылке проходить через VPN, что, вероятно, именно то, что вам нужно. В мире cisco вы хотите DVMRPс протоколом разрешения следующего шага (NHRP).